MDLA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

208 of the 5,746 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Medallia, Inc. (MDLA)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$4.34B — up 8.6% from $4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 48 funds opened new MDLA positions and 32 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 71 added to existing stakes and 61 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$75M. The largest seller was SC US (TTGP), cutting an estimated $336M.
